Transaction 3c16471bba07ce0c3c7423b51772bcf9e5c89cb17ddd0080f6040a521e0de26f
1 Input
1 Output
-
3c16471bba07ce0c3c7423b51772bcf9e5c89cb17ddd0080f6040a521e0de26f:0
- value
- 93436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acf214c77e5b3d4d161fd7a8f7211870201c28dc OP_EQUAL
- address
- 3HTU9dfxPXf8R7RMG9xrRj4b66ZeQHTLi2